As Invisible Theatre was designed as a form of protest (Theatre of the Oppressed, Augusto Boal and Panagiotis Assimakopoulos) it would make sense to come up with a piece that may be reflected in the lecture.
Invisible Theatre is not a form of Candid Camera etc, as this type of 'theatre' has nothing to do with showing oppression within society.
